General annotation (Comments)
| Function | Catalyzes the ferredoxin-dependent oxidative decarboxylation of arylpyruvates By similarity. |
| Catalytic activity | (Indol-3-yl)pyruvate + CoA + 2 oxidized ferredoxin = S-2-(indol-3-yl)acetyl-CoA + CO2 + 2 reduced ferredoxin + H+. |
| Subunit structure | Heterodimer of the iorA and iorB subunits. |
